The process of selling FIL on Binance Exchange

When selling FIL on Binance, select the appropriate trading pair (e.g., FIL/USDT) and choose between a market order for immediate execution or a limit order for a specific price.

Step 1: Log In and Navigate to the Trading Interface

Log into your Binance account and access the "Trade" tab from the navigation menu. On the trading interface, select the "Spot" option from the drop-down menu on the left-hand side.

Step 2: Choose the FIL Trading Pair

In the search bar under "Select Trading Pair," type in "FIL" and select the desired trading pair, such as FIL/USDT. This indicates that you want to sell your FIL tokens for USDT.

Step 3: Place a Sell Order

Locate the order form on the right-hand side of the screen. Select the "Sell" option and specify the amount of FIL you wish to sell in the "Amount" field. You can also choose from the preset percentages of available FIL to sell, such as 25%, 50%, or 100%.

Step 4: Select an Order Type

  • Limit Order: Allows you to specify the exact price at which you want to sell your FIL. This ensures that your order will only be executed when the market price reaches or exceeds the specified price.
  • Market Order: Executes your order immediately at the current best available market price. This type of order is suitable for situations where you want to sell your FIL quickly.

Step 5: Monitor the Order Status

Once you place an order, it will appear in the "Open Orders" section. You can monitor the status of your order and adjust or cancel it as needed.

Step 6: Managing Funds

After your sell order is executed, the USDT proceeds will be credited to your Binance account. You can withdraw these funds to your external wallet or use them to trade other cryptocurrencies.

FAQs:

Q: What are the fees associated with selling FIL on Binance?

A: Binance charges a trading fee for each order executed. The fee varies based on your VIP level and the type of order you place.

Q: Can I sell FIL directly for my local currency?

A: Currently, Binance does not offer direct trading pairs of FIL with fiat currencies. You must first sell your FIL for a cryptocurrency like USDT and then convert it to your local currency.

Q: What is the minimum amount of FIL I can sell on Binance?

A: The minimum amount of FIL you can sell on Binance varies depending on the trading pair. For the FIL/USDT pair, the minimum order amount is 0.001 FIL.

Q: How long does it take for a sell order to be executed?

A: The execution time for a sell order depends on the order type and market conditions. Limit orders may take longer to execute if the market price has not reached the specified price. Market orders are typically executed immediately.

Q: What should I do if my sell order is not executed?

A: If your sell order is not executed, it may be because the market price has not yet reached the specified price (for limit orders) or because there is insufficient liquidity. You can adjust the price or cancel the order and try again.
